Output 7ab46bb04188a8e917d5f39708b2e340b103bea2f4a5da4ae46175d1afa8cb1d:1

value
19592714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b71f397ff71b604747b4e10bc289e9bc3a273e OP_EQUAL
address
35DiyNU34Mrk473C51PtKkexYuc1BqedsL
transaction
7ab46bb04188a8e917d5f39708b2e340b103bea2f4a5da4ae46175d1afa8cb1d
confirmations
305761
spent
true